A/sub n/ method in monokinetic neutron transport theory: Convergence and numerical applications

Description
The convergence of the approximate method, referred to as A/sub n/, to study the solution of the monokinetic transport equation is fully investigated, when it is applied to the description of the neutron population in both infinite and finite media
